in addition to keratinocytes, the stratum spinosum also contains another epidermal cell type called epidermal ______ cells that
WARRIOR [948]

Keratinocytes are differentiated skin cells found in the outermost layer of the epidermis. Dendritic cells are antigen-presenting cells that play important roles in the adaptive immune response.

  • In addition to keratinocytes, the <em>stratum spinosum</em> also contains another epidermal cell type called epidermal DENDRITIC cells that help to fight infection.

  • The s<em>tratum spinosum</em><em> </em>is an epidermal skin layer between the <em>stratum granulosum </em>and<em> stratum basale</em>.

  • Dendritic cells are antigen-presenting cells that are capable of processing harmful antigens in order to present them on the cell surface to the T cells of the immune system.

4. Which of the following elements does not want to have eight valence electrons? a. magnesium c. hydrogen b. oxygen d. nitrogen
Cloud [144]

Answer:

Hydrogen.

Explanation:

Hydrogen is the simplest chemical element that exists. The symbol for the chemical element Hydrogen is "H" and it is a colourless, tasteless, odorless, and highly flammable gas.

Hydrogen is a chemical element found in group (1) of the periodic table and as such it has one (1) electrons in its outermost shell. Therefore, Hydrogen has an atomic number of one (1) and a single valence electrons because it has only one proton and one electron in its nucleus.

Based on the octet rule which states that atoms of chemical elements gain, lose or share electrons so as to have eight (8) electrons in their valence shell. Therefore, atoms of chemical elements bond in order to attain the electronic configuration of a noble gas i.e a full valence shell which comprises of eight (8) electrons.

However, the chemical element "Hydrogen" is an exception to the octet rule because it is only able to hold a maximum of two (2) valence electrons in its outermost shell to become full.

<em>Hence, Hydrogen is an element which does not want to have eight valence electrons. </em>
